Omnicom Precision Marketing is seeking a Data Analyst to support measurement and performance analytics. You will conduct in-depth analysis, assist with website analytics tagging, and build dashboards to inform client recommendations and insights.
The role emphasizes learning and growth in CRM, data and martech, with collaboration across cross-functional teams in a fast-paced environment.
